94 jeep cherokee will not turn over

When you turn the key the starter is not working you jump the starter out and make it crank.

Bad neutral safety switch, starter relay, starter fuse or bad ignition switch. You will have to check each of those things to find what's keeping the current from reaching the starter, when you try cranking.

SOURCE: My 1995 grand jeep cherokee won't start but It

alarm systems on these vehicles will normally have a start then stall condition. then a lockout. if it doesnt start at all I would first suspect fuel problem. if when u turn your key on listen to fuel filler neck to see if u can hear pump run for 2-3 sec. if u can hear it run you may have a crank sensor or cam sensor failure. those 2 control spark and your engine will not fire unless both inputs are supplied.

94 jeep cherokee has no power at the starter.when key is turned

Check neutral safety switch... On automatic AW4 transmission it's on the passenger side, directly across from gear selector shaft. The two inner terminals on the side opposite the clip lever on the harness connector are the ones that operate starter. If you jump across these you should get voltage baqck to the small wire on the starter solenoid.(trigger) The switch itself is about $200, but can be rebuilt or replaced with a salvage yard part cheaply. Get a manual fro removal, and follow them carefully. PS: connector is up near ;the trans dipstick!

94 grand cherokee will not start after giving a jump start...

does it turn over? if it clicks and then stops really fast, it's your starter. don't worry, if it's the 4.0L it's an easy fix. 3 bolts and a hundred bucks and you'll be on your way. however, if all the interior electronics work, but when you turn the key nothing happens, you need to go through and clean all the electrical grounds and battery connecters. it happened to me (ironically my starter went out too) but that is the general problem. 1st gen grand cherokees are notorious for bad grounds.
